With ...Across North America, graduates with a magna cum laude distinction are usually within the top 10% to 15% of their graduating class. The highest honor, in terms of traditionally accepted Latin honors, is the summa cum laude distinction, which is used to represent students who graduate within the top 5% of their class. To graduate “with Distinction” or “with Highest Distinction” a student must have completed at least 45 academic hours at UNC-CH and have obtained a cumulative grade point average of at least 3.5 and 3.8 respectively.
